Position Summary 

Supervisor Project Controls (SPC) position provides day-to-day leadership, direction, management and oversight of assigned project controls resources. SPCs are expected to lead/direct assigned resources in review of project controls status (cost, contract, WBS, schedule, resource, etc.). This position is critical to day-to-day coaching and mentoring of Project Controls Specialists.

SPCs assure project control data collection tools, analysis, communication and reporting systems used by assigned resources are available and functioning according to Enterprise policies (e.g. Financial, Risk, Supply Chain, etc) and Project Management Center of Excellence (PMCoE) requirements. The SPC position requires application of project controls principles. SPCs are front-line leaders that demonstrate advanced level comprehension, application and analysis of data associated with projects, programs and portfolios. Demonstration is routinely associated with extensive and diverse work experience and formal education.

SPCs guide assigned unit resources in performing complex aspects of project estimating, scheduling, change control and cost management while aggregating and reporting program or portfolio level performance using prescribed methods and tools. The SPC must be proficient with various computer applications for analytics related to schedule, cost, and risk. SPCs lead communication of project, program and portfolio performance including identification of trends and forecasts. SPC leads the team through analysis and results of project cost, forecasts, contracts, schedules, resources etc.

SPCs serve an essential position of leadership within the project team and assign resources to ensure support of Project Leads, Project Managers and Project Directors on projects and programs of varying size and complexity. This position is restricted on the basis of business need.

Responsibilities 

Lead Project Controls Team

Support the Manager – Project Controls with organizing the Project Controls function within an assigned business unit by assisting development, revision or adoption of systems, processes, staffing or organizational design models to deliver on roles and responsibilities. If the unit is not already in place, this may include recommending appropriate number of PC’s of varying levels of expertise for scheduling, cost estimating, cost controls, scope controls, analysis and evaluation. Establish relationships with functional managers and managers of project managers to assure appropriate organizational design.

Lead Development / Generation of Periodic Project Controls Communications

Provide leadership in development and generation of daily, weekly, monthly and quarterly project controls communications and reports. Provide tools/systems for data collection, verify, validate and analyze data to support project controls communications and reporting. Assure distribution and archival of project controls reports as appropriate. Provide presentation quality reports and communications as needed to project and management teams.

Execute Excellence in Project/Program Change Control

Lead PC resources in tracking and managing changes to project scope, schedule and cost. Assure identification, assessment, approval, and distribution of change requests, change notices or change orders in a manner compliant with internal governance standards, and terms and conditions of relevant contracts. Lead teams in audit reviews and reporting.

Lead Project Controls Benchmarking and Self-Assessment Initiatives

Lead benchmarking and self-assessment initiatives to stay current and on leading edge of excellence relevant to project controls and services typically managed by the project controls group. Determine and assure adoption of identified improvement opportunities and best practices to address gaps in performance.

Expertise in Project Controls Methodologies

Develops and maintains systems for creating a) common Work Breakdown Structures (WBS),b) project schedules, c) cost estimates, d) systems to track and trend cash flow projections, e) project change control documentation, and f) communications associated with project controls. Provide systems that track and communicate project status, performs project controls related analyses at a level appropriate for projects/programs for the assigned business.

Effective Team Leadership

Establishes effective relationships with customers (project management & sponsor organizations) to support resolution of project/programs controls issues and requirements. Lead the PC activities toward excellence in identifying and creating necessary project controls systems.
